FAQ about NAOETSU port (JPNAO) — Japan
Key information on NAOETSU Port.
NAOETSU (UN/Locode: JPNAO), Japan is a seaport located at approximately 37.19239° N, 138.26090° E.
What type of vessels NAOETSU Port handles?
Port usage is Tanker (51.69%), Cargo (44.94%), Passenger (2.25%) and Other (1.12%).
Where is NAOETSU Port located?
Coordinates: 37.19239° N, 138.26090° E.

What vessel types and sizes do NAOETSU Port handle?
Vessel types historically calling: Bulk Carrier, Container, Gas Carrier, General Cargo, Passenger, Tanker and Tugs Harbor Craft. Typical extremes observed (AIS-derived): max LOA: 298; max beam: 49; max draft: 12.52; max DWT: 95,418; max GT: 136894; max NT: 41069; min LOA: 55; min beam: 10; min draft: 2.6; min DWT: 1000; min GT: 498; min NT: 9 and build year: 1991.
